Background:With a rapidly ageing population, the number of wrist fractures will rise dramatically in the super-elderly (>80 years) group. In previous published studies regarding mortality after wrist fractures elderly are often defined using a rather wide age-span, the threshold has been set to somewhere between 50-70 years. This text focuses on the presence of calcium and phosphorus in connection with copper-alloy residue on the inside of melting crucibles from south Sweden dated to the late Bronze Age (ca. 1100 - 500 BC). The decarbonization of the energy-intensive and natural-resourced-based industries is associated with potentially large economic costs. In this paper, I explore how decarbonization may affect the profitability and market value of these industries. Despite the large scientific interest on robot learning forobject picking tasks, the research on object placingis too limited. Commonly, placing is simplistically consideredas a trivial task, but real life manipulation problems indicatethe exact opposite. Amyloid protein aggregation results in major disturbances of cellular processes in humans. The most common amyloid-related disorders are Alzheimer´s disease and Parkinson´s disease. Parkinson´s disease is charaterized by the formation of protein-rich aggregates that are deposited in neurons, termed Lewy bodies and Lewy neurites. All animals and some bacteria can synthesize linear polysaccharides with a backbone of repeating disaccharideunits, called glycosaminoglycans (GAGs). The GAGs are either attached to a protein core, as in proteoglycans (PGs), or exist as free polymer chains, as in hyaluronan. This essay deals with the tantric sect Aghora; its belief system, ritual practices and similarities with the Kapalika sect. Aghora exhibits peculiar and controversial ritual practices; for example the shava sadhana during which the aghori meditates on top of a corpse and then consumes part of it in order to reach identification with the god Shiva or the state of non-discrimination called aghor.
